Phalanx
One of the bones in the fingers or toes, each hand or foot typically has fourteen phalanges (plural for phalanx).
Subpubic Angle
The angle formed below the pubic symphysis in the pelvis, differing in shape between sexes and important in determining the sex of skeletal remains.
Pelvis
The pelvis is a bony structure located in the lower part of the torso, enclosing the pelvic cavity and comprising the pelvic bones, supporting the spinal column and anchoring the lower limbs.
Sesamoid Bones
Small, round bones typically found embedded within tendons, acting to alter the direction of muscle forces and reduce friction.
